The online world has also authorized greater broadcasting of sports occasions, the two in movie and audio varieties and thru no cost and membership channels. With a web broadcast, even a locally broadcast high school football game may be heard throughout the world on any system using an audio output and an Connection to the internet.

Syndication networks gave method to regional sports networks, which carried broadcasts of local sports with a significantly increased scale than total-service broadcast stations could deliver at some time; these combined with out-of-marketplace sports offers (which debuted while in the nineties) allowed the carriage of such networks' sporting activities across the country. Having said that, Along with the improved availability of sports to broadcast came raising rights fees, which may very well be recovered with the newly approved apply of amassing retransmission consent charges from cable subscribers, that has resulted in numerous disputes plus the dropping of channels from cable lineups. Personal leagues commenced launching their own personal networks within the 2000s; specialty networks of other sports have experienced varying levels of results.

The large expense of media legal rights has triggered consolidation from the marketplace, with a few broadcasters merging or forming partnerships to share the money load and grow their get to.
